The elements of a paragraph Introduction: Paragraphs are one of the major building blocks of good writing. They are used to organize information in an essay, a story or an article. When writing paragraphs, we usually include several parts. Read the second paragraph of the magazine article Population movement in the USA and try to find which sentence in this paragraph gives the main point of the whole paragraph. The sentence which gives the main point of a paragraph or an article is the topic sentence. 1. Topic sentences: ● Each paragraph should have a point. This is usually expressed in a topic sentence, which clearly states what information the paragraph will give. Not all paragraphs have a topic sentence. This is sometimes the case when, for example, a paragraph is continuing a topic introduced in the previous paragraph, which contained a topic sentence. The topic sentence is usually the first sentence of a paragraph. However, in the first paragraph of an essay, a story or an article, the topic sentence may follow a hook, which is often an interesting fact, a question or a quotation. Read the second paragraph under the subtitle of ‘Bright lights, big city’ and identify the topic sentence and supporting sentences in it. Think about why a question is used at the beginning of the paragraph. A question instead of an affirmative sentence here can catch readers’ eyes and make readers more interested in the topic. A question like this is called a hook. Read the second paragraph again. In this paragraph, what information can we get from the sentences following the first sentence? (The following sentences give more detailed information about the move, as where older Americans move from, where they move to and how old they are.) These sentences are called supporting sentences. 2. Supporting sentences ● The topic sentence should be followed by sentences which help explain or prove it.
